Produce architecture blueprints that guide the development and implementation of Cloud solutions across multiple products, providing direction to technical teams during project delivery and ensuring implementations support technology and product roadmaps. The Cloud Solutions Architect provides their expertise in the development and maintenance of architecture standards and solutions that align with strategic goals and partner with product managers, business analysts, designers, and software engineers to navigate solution decisions.

Responsibilities:

  • Design, implement, and manage scalable cloud infrastructures in Azure to support AI model deployments, ensuring high availability and reliability.
  • Collaborate with the AI Engineering team to streamline the deployment of machine learning models, optimizing the use of cloud resources for performance and cost-efficiency.
  • Develop and enforce security best practices for Azure resources, including identity and access management, data protection, and compliance monitoring.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ues related to cloud infrastructure and model deployments, ensuring minimal downtime and efficient problem resolution.

Skills and Knowledge:

  • Knowledge of enterprise cloud solutions, deploying and running solutions in a cloud environment, and private, public, and hybrid clouds
  • Extensive experience with Internet technologies and protocols like TCP/IP, VPN, SSL and HTTP
  • Hands-on experience with public and private cloud services (Azure, AWS, Openstack, VMWare, ect) as well as load balancers and networking devices
  • Experience designing high availability and disaster recovery / fail-over infrastructures
  • Development experience with database or application integration technology
  • Deep knowledge of Linux fundamentals
  • Knowledge of open-source architectures and/or past contributions to open-source projects
  • Design, development and operations experience with highly available, scalable, and fault tolerant systems
  • Experience with Data Science project lifecycle (Azure ML Studio, AI Foundry, Key Vault, Fabric, Storage Account, Language Studio, EventHub, Azure Functions, App Service, Logic Apps, API Management, Microsoft Purview, Azure Cosmos DB, Azure Kubernetes Services (AKS), Azure Container Apps, Azure Container Instances (ACI), Managed Endpoints, Private Endpoint, Virtual Network)
  • Experience with agile/scrum methodologies
  • Professional Cloud Solutions Architect (PCSA) Certification.
  • 2+ years of experience.
